1. The Evolution of Data Management: A Focus on Real-Time Analytics

One of the most significant trends in database design and optimization today is the shift towards real-time analytics. Traditional databases were designed for batch processing and historical data analysis, but modern applications require real-time insights and decision-making capabilities. This shift is driven by the increasing importance of big data and the Internet of Things (IoT).

# Practical Insight: Implementing Real-Time Data Pipelines

To harness the power of real-time analytics, organizations are adopting data pipelines that can process and analyze data as it is generated. Technologies like Apache Kafka and Apache Flink are becoming essential tools for real-time data processing. Companies can optimize their database design to support these pipelines by ensuring that data is structured in a way that facilitates quick querying and analysis.

2. Cloud-Native Databases: Embracing Scalability and Agility

Another major trend is the rise of cloud-native databases. These databases are designed to operate seamlessly in a cloud environment, offering significant advantages in terms of scalability, agility, and cost-efficiency. Cloud providers like AWS, Google Cloud, and Microsoft Azure are continuously innovating to offer more robust and secure cloud-native database solutions.

# Practical Insight: Leveraging Serverless Architecture

Serverless architectures, which are part of many cloud-native database solutions, allow organizations to focus on their core business logic without worrying about the underlying infrastructure. By leveraging serverless capabilities, companies can achieve automatic scaling, pay-for-use pricing, and reduced operational overhead. This makes it easier for businesses to scale their database operations as needed, without the burden of managing physical servers.

3. Artificial Intelligence and Machine Learning in Database Optimization

Artificial Intelligence (AI) and Machine Learning (ML) are revolutionizing database design and optimization. These technologies can help automate many aspects of database management, from query optimization to anomaly detection. Machine learning models can learn patterns in data and predict future trends, enabling more efficient and intelligent database operations.

# Practical Insight: Automating Query Optimization

One practical application of AI and ML in database optimization is automating query performance tuning. Machine learning algorithms can analyze query performance data and suggest optimizations, such as creating new indexes or reorganizing data structures. This not only improves query performance but also reduces the workload on database administrators, allowing them to focus on other critical tasks.

4. Blockchain and Distributed Ledgers: A New Frontier in Database Design

Blockchain technology is another innovative development that is beginning to impact database design and optimization. Distributed ledgers offer a new way to handle transactional data, providing features like immutability, transparency, and security. While still in its early stages, blockchain technology has the potential to transform how databases are structured and managed.

# Practical Insight: Implementing a Hybrid Approach

To explore the benefits of blockchain without completely overhauling existing systems, many organizations are adopting a hybrid approach. They use blockchain for specific use cases, such as supply chain management or financial transactions, while maintaining traditional databases for other operations. This allows companies to leverage the strengths of blockchain without disrupting their existing infrastructure.
